RingConn's Study Highlights Advances in Wearable Health Monitoring
RingConn, under its parent company Ninenovo, has made significant strides in wearable health technology. A joint study involving Shanghai Jiao Tong University and Mianyang Central Hospital analyzed 97,559 valid PPG samples from 1,810 participants. Published in npj Digital Medicine, the study explores the potential of bilateral cardiovascular monitoring using wearable rings, overcoming longstanding accuracy issues in consumer wearables.
The research disclosed promising outcomes in heart rate estimation by synchronizing PPG signals from both hands, reducing errors significantly. While improvements in blood pressure estimations were modest, the study confirms the importance of signal consistency and sensor placement.
As cardiovascular disease remains a leading cause of death worldwide, this study could enhance accessible and continuous health monitoring. RingConn's commitment to investing in hardware and data algorithms positions it at the forefront of digital health solutions.
